I toggle between Vertex, Edge, and Face Select mode constantly. In a speed modeling session, this adds a lot of clicks.

I couldn't find any place to set a hotkey to change this setting. Is there one?

Try Ctrl+Tab .

When the menu appears choose the appropriate letter:

V Vertex select

E Edge select

F Face select

Alternatively you can use numbers: 1, 2, and 3

The tooltip shows the Python in case you decide to assign a single keystroke.
